I don't know if I just got double dose in my blood but my mom's side is Puerto Rican and her Her mother's family, much so my grandma, were all mediums. they they delved into that pretty hard from my understanding. So there there's whatever that may bring On my dad's side, I have the Nz Pice And his grandfather was apparently a high up freemason So there's a lot of talk about Freemasons and things that they do So I don't know if all this kind of cultivated into generational curses or anything like that. I don't know. Blood seems to be important bloodlines and all that stuff. so I've kind of thought about it and I've wondered Nothing I can confirm, you know. So growing up then, did you were you aware of the medium practices as a child? Was that something that you didn't know about No, I didn't know about that until it was about. thirteen or fourteen But everything before that was just scary stuff but I my earliest memories would be when I was just the littleittlest kids, we had a house in Sacramento And it was a rented house. Yeah, we rented a house Some of my earliest memories were waking up in the middle of the night and hearing something in the kitchen And I would run And I would run to my parents room, I'd jump into the bed scared And my earliest prayers were for God to take my hearing away, so I didn't have to hear the scary noises in. And it sounded like somebody moving, opening fridges, shutting cabinets. All sorts of stuff, and nobody was up. Nobody was around.
